Steven Ma Suffers on Rides - Unwell Bernice Watches the Fun
Steven Ma, Bernice Liu, Ron Ng, Shirley Yeung and Kenneth Ma were among the cast memebers promoting "The Brink of Law" at the Tamar Site Carnival yesterday. They had originally planned to go on three of the rides, but after two, they had already had enough, so they changed the third activity to a sidestall to try and win prizes. In the end, it was Steven's team that won overall. Whilst Steven was going on the 'Speed Windmill' ride, the safety mechanism was pressing on his sensitive regions, but Ron and Kenneth were fine. Steven laughs: "Well, I am more well endowed than them!"

The stars split into two groups to go on the slide and rides and when Steven went on them, he could not keep his eyes open. He says: "I am not afraid of heights, but I am afraid of the pull against gravity. I usually just go on the merry-go-round, but seeing the girls going on the rides as well, then I couldn't pull out. I have had an irregular heartbeat since I was a child, so I was worried about fainting if I get over-excited."

Steven went on to warn the men about going on this ride, because his genitals were being crushed by the safety mechanism all through his ride. He laughs: "I asked Kenneth about it, but he said he didn't feel anything. (Maybe you have more there?) Well I am more endowed, in the show, they all call me big brother!" Steven understands the need for the harness, but he feels that it does not cater for the feelings of their male customers and if he was a little fatter, then it could have crushed them entirely. Asked if he was in pain, he laughs: "Well we are very elastic! I can handle it." As for the chance of him fainting, he decided against going on the rather exhilarating 'G Force' ride and opted to throw balls to win toys instead because he has quite a good aim and once won over twenty toys for his nephew.

Ron used to love going on rides, but now he is very scared and has become less brave. Talking of Steven's crushing experience, he asks: "So strong? I didn't have it! I was just bothered about holding onto the water balloon. (Have you brought a girlfriend before to win toys?) I tried the game three or four years ago, but I did not have a girlfriend then. Usually when I go dating, we will go to the cinema and rarely play games. Buying them is better because sometimes you can spend several hundred dollars and just win one toy, so it is better to just buy one." Kenneth just has a cameo role in the show and his character has already died. He jokes: "I am wondering why they have asked a dead person to come and do this promotion. (Steven had a crushing problem with the safety latch?) I didn't. Maybe he has more than me."

Shirley dropped her water balloon very early on when she was on the ride and she says it has been eight or nine years since she went on a ride. Although she is not afraid of heights, she is very afraid of the forces and gravity, so she was a little dizzy afterwards. Asked if she will bring her boyfriend to go on the rides, she says she will not because the only reason she is going on them is for work. As for her role in the show being the villain, she says that some viewers have complimented her performance and not scolded her. This has given her a great satisfaction. Later in the show, she will be even more evil, getting someone to rape Kate Tsui's character and then murder people, so this may be a shock to the viewers.

Bernice has been working too hard lately and has become unwell, with her voice being husky for over two weeks and still unwell at yesterday's event. She is also suffering from an imbalance in her ears, so she dare not go on the rides at the amusement park yesterday, just supporting from the side. She says: "I suffer from vertigo and even if was not unwell, I cannot go on overly exhilarating rides. The most I will go on is a big wheel."

Bernice's dedication can be seen by all, so she thinks that this illness was brought on by her schedule being too packed. She says: "I had to go to hospital on two occasions because I had a high fever and I even fainted in my home. Luckily my uncle was around." Although the company has allowed her to take a few days off to rest, she does not want to affect the progress of her series, so she was rushing to get back to work. She says: "The company is very good, the work over the past few days has been very easy and relaxed, so I have paid for drinks and snacks for the cast and crew."

She also smiles that maybe because she won the award at the JSG awards and this left her too happy and so she developed a fever from the excitement. Asked if rumoured boyfriend Moses Chan has congratulated her, she syas: "I have not received a congratulatory message from him. (Will you celebrate with him?) No, because I have already paid for everyone's food."

Steven Ma Denies Falling Out with Bernice Liu
Steven Ma and Bernice Liu were filming yesterday for new series "The Entire City Dances" and they made their responses to an untrue rumour. They were filming an argument scene earlier, but when the press took the photograph of the scene, they suggested that Bernice kept having NG's (outtakes) and this made Steven angry. Steven says: "The reporters did ask me some questions, but I just talked about the storyline. I also said that having worked with Bernice before, we had an understanding. With such a serious answer, they still had to make something up."

Steven hopes that in the Year of the Pig, he can distance himself from such pointless reports: "My sign clashes with the stars this year, but it is not too bad. There will not be so much luck in romance, but there will be a lot of people helping me out and I have even received an offer of work for a stage show in April in America and Canada." Bernice says: "There is no need to clarify these things, the viewers who have watched me for a while will understand. When I was filming for 'Healing Hands', they siad I was always losing my temper, but that was what my character was like!"

Watery Promotion for "The Brink of Law"
TVB will begin airing new series "The Brink of Law" on Monday and a promotional event was held at a hotel swimming pool yesterday morning, attended by cast members including Steven Ma, Ron Ng, Shirley Yeung, Sherming Yiu, June Chan, Karen Lee, Yoyo Chan and Kenneth Ma. Ron arrived 45 minutes late and was first to be pushed into the pool as a punishment by the girls, whilst producer Mui Siu Ching said to him on the microphone: "Don't be late next time!" Afterwards, Ron said that Siu Ching was right and he knows what he did was wrong. He says: "Sorry, I feel bad because I set my alarm wrong. The event started at 11am, but I set the alarm to go off at 11:30."

Although it was quite cold yesterday, the pool was heated, so the girls all appeared in their swimsuits and showed off their figures in the water. Shirley's costume was quite conservative though and she says this is because they have to play games so she had to avoid exposing herself, so she chose a sportier swimsuit. As a result, with their better figures, Sherming, June and Karen stole most of the limelight in their bikinis. Shirley said graciously: "It doesn't matter, it is all just for the promotion. (Does your boyfriend not like you looking sexy?) Of course not! The most important thing was not to expose myself during the games." Shirley had to rush off to another event afterwards, so she was keeping a close guard on her hairstyle during the games and avoiding getting it wet.

Kenneth appeared wearing two pairs of shorts, cycling and beach shorts and he smiles: "It doesn't really matter what the men wear, we are all just here to see the ladies." As he does not know how to swim, he was just concerned about not getting embarrassed and not drowning and therefore he did not mind not winning the games. He smiles: "I play football, but I won't find love doing that, so I want to start playing badminton instead! (Is your new year wish to look for a girlfriend?) No, making money still comes first. When I sort myself out, then it will be easier."

Steven also appeared in his cycling shorts and did not wear any swimming trunks. He says that since he was young, he usually wears shorts because he says his bum looks too good and when he wears cycling shorts then other people get jealous. Asked if he would wear trunks to do a fashion show, he says: "You would have to give me time to get fit and a large six-figure sum as a fee because it would be my first time. I was approached by a thermal underwear company from the mainland earlier, but underwear is a little too close fitting, so I turned it down." If the ratings are good for "Brink" will you wear some small trunks? He says: "I am very miserly when it comes to these things. Give me more money because I am guarding my first time. When the right situation arises and the reward is right, then I will give my debut performance."

Steven also says that each time a new series is released, then people will pledge to appear in swimwear, but this rarely materialises. He finds this a little boring so promising a big meal is more practical. What would be a suitable rating for the first week? He says: "I hope for above thirty, because the ratings for 'Dicey Business' were not bad and we should be able to follow them."

Shirley Yeung Reveals Steven Ma has a Female Visitor to Set
Shirley Yeung and Steven Ma were invited onto a CRHK radio show for an interview yesterday and Shirley suddenly revealed that whilst they were filming earlier, Steven had a pretty girl visiting him on the set and bringing him Turtle Herb Jelly, so it seems that Steven has a new love in his life. When asked about this further, Steven seemed a little embarrassed and hesitant, saying that even if he was dating, he would not reveal it.

Steven worked together with Shirley in "The Brink of Law" which is currently airing and Shirley revealed that during filming, she noticed a pretty girl visiting him. Shirley says she does not know the girl, but she is very respectable. She did not show any intimate behaviour with Steven, so it seems they are just friends. Asked about this, Steven said she was just a friend and of course she is respectable. For people to visit him on set is a very ordinary occurrence. When the reporters pushed the point that to visit them at work, then this person must be quite close, he looked over at Shirley and laughed: "This is all your fault!" Steven insists he is not embarrassed, but as she is from outside the industry, then the less he says, the better. Asked if he will keep this relationship underground, he feels that until a relationship reaches the final stage then there is no point in saying too much. When the time comes to get married, then he will go public, but he will not talk about dating.

Shirley realised she had said too much and tried to make things up by pointing out that she has only seen the girl once and she does not feel that Steven is always on the phone. Steven smiled as he said to Shirley: "And I look after you so well." Shirley was very apologetic to Steven and said: "I know." Steven says that she didn't mean it though, so he will not be mad at her.

"The Brink of Law" Promotion
TVB's new series "The Brink of Law" will begin airing next Monday after the end of "Dicey Business". As this show deals with combatting illegal gambling on horses, a group of cast members took part in a promotional event at the Shatin Racecourse and those present included Steven Ma, Bernice Liu, Shirley Yeung, Kate Tsui, Michelle Yim, Ron Ng and Kenneth Ma. As well as playing games, the stars also posed for photographs with the horses. However, they were not very co-operative, losing his temper and leaving droppings everywhere, so there was a lot of waiting around before they could successfully complete the photographs. During the shooting game, Steven accidentally aimed the gun at the floor, dropping all the pellets and causing everyone to laugh at him. Ron was blindfolded for his shot and this frightened everyone into running away.

Steven appeared wearing a smart suit and he smiles that he only realised yesterday that he only had one tie at home that he has worn before, so he had no choice but to wear it again. This is Steven's first show to be aired after winning an award at last year's Anniversary awards and he feels that this series has given him the chance to work with many new faces and will help him create some new chemistry.

Steven points out that in the show he plays brothers with Kenneth Ma and they are both referred to as 'Ma Jai' as a nickname. There is also a crew member from props who is called 'Ma Jai', so there are three of them. Originally, the crew had decided to refer to Steven as 'Siu Ma Gor', but he felt that this was rather sensitive, so in the end, they decided on calling Steven 'Ma Jai', Kenneth 'Ma Ming' and the crew member 'Ma Ye'.

There were reports yesterday that Steven was forcefully pushing himself into photographs with an old granny. To this he responds: "I am innocent!" He explains that the granny had asked him earlier to have his photo taken with her, but because she stood away, he ran up to her to avoid her coming back, so it was all a misunderstanding. With these reports already so early on into 2007, Steven says: "I don't mind, it shows my attraction. At first, I was a bit shocked that they were reporting about an old lady, but I don't really mind about reports like this."

Ron had earlier been linked with Toby Leung in rumours during the filming for "Men in Pain" and with the news breaking that he had spent New Years Eve celebrating with her and Raymond Lam in a bar, then of course the press questioned him about this. He says: "Raymond Lam was also there that night and a male artiste from the mainland artiste who is wokring with us in 'The Drive of Life'. We openly allowed the press to take photographs." He says that Toby also had other friends in the bar and as they played lovers in 'Men in Pain' and again in 'The Drive of Life', then they are good friends.

Asked if he is interested in courting her, he smiles: "No, she is an executive's daughter! (Are you not brave enough to pursue?) No, we are just friends." There were also reports that he and Raymond were drunk on that night and only left the bar at 11am the next day. Ron syas that it was their friend who was drunk and they waited together for him to wake up before leaving together. Of course they also drank, because having a little alcohol on New Years Eve is no problem.

So does going to a bar with Raymond make him a big hit with the girls? He syas that there were a lot of other friends there. Asked who he hugged after the countdown, he says that he was taking part in the countdown in Yuen Long and then he hugged Raymond. Asked if he would like to regain some popularity with "The Brink of Law", he played along and says: "Yes I want to spring back."

Bernice was born in the year of the horse, so she has always loved horses. When she was younger, she once told her mother not to have a pet dog any more and keep a pet horse instead, laughing that it could live under her bed. she says that Michelle did take her to the racecourse to experience it before and she realised that people in Hong Kong own horses to race, but if she was to own a horse, then she would keep in the grassy fields of Canada. Talking of her role in this new series, Bernice says that it is a new trial for her because as well as being slapped by Michelle, she is also hit by Eliott Yue.

Kate was dressed in a short skirt, revealing her rather thick legs. She says that she has been working on losing weight and has already reduced a lot of water mass. She has recently been introduced by a friend for a detox treatment that has reduced her water retention and now she has to depend on machines to help her slim the bottom half of her body. However, this is quite expensive, so she has to work hard to make money to stay beautiful. She also says that when she was filming for "On the First Beat" (aka 'Cadets on the Beat') she was like a tomboy so she lost interest in making herself up. Now she is filming for "The Entire City Dances" and has the chance to wear pretty clothing again, so she is starting to concentrate on her appearance again.

Recently the fortune tellers have said that Shirley has good luck this year and a chance of getting married in 2007. She smiles that she is happy to hear that she will have good luck, but she will not be getting married so soon. She says: "Unless it is a lightning marriage, but I don't think so. (What if there was a third person?) What? A dog? No. I like my job at the moment." She says that she has dated her boyfriend for several years and it is fashionable to have a long marathon of love, but she does intend to have children after she gets married. Shirley indicates that usually she does not dare to have her fortune read because it is ok if they say something good, but if they say something bad, then it will leave a shadow.
